Prepare the Steamer:
Pour about 1–2 inches of water into a pot and place a steamer basket inside. Make sure water doesn’t touch the eggs.
Heat the Water:
Bring the water to a gentle boil over medium heat.
Steam the Eggs:
Place eggs in the steamer basket and cover with a lid.
Steam according to your desired doneness:
Soft-boiled: 6–7 minutes
Medium: 8–9 minutes
Hard-boiled: 10–12 minutes
Cool the Eggs:
Immediately transfer the eggs to an ice bath to stop cooking and make peeling easier.
